RAPEX Issues Warning on LED Lighting Chain Made in China for Electric Shock

On Aug. 2, the Rapid Alert System for Non-food Consumer Products issued a warning on LED lighting chain once again. It is understood that this warned product is LED lighting chain from China-based "B10Cod'Events", the notifying country of this case is France.

This LED lighting chain is for interior use, and its type/number of model is LED 5EIN193, Organization for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) Portal Category is 78000000 - Electrical Supplies. The product poses a risk of electric shock because the insulation between the active parts and the accessible parts of the LED is insufficient. The product does not comply with the Low Voltage Directive (LVD) and the relevant European standard EN 60598.

Currently, importers / distributors have taken voluntary measures, such as, withdrawal of the product from the market, recall of the product from end users, and destruction of the product. Therefore, it is recommended that the manufacturers and exporters should attach great importance.
